Simplifying omnichannel communications

As important as omnichannel delivery is to keeping customers satisfied, it’s far from easy. The more delivery channels, the more complexity is introduced for managing data, keeping the process secure and getting the right communication and messaging to the right person.

That’s just the start. You need to track which emails bounce or are not opened and texts that don’t go through, and set up a process for determining when to switch to print and mail communications. Returned mail also has to be handled and customer records updated.

On top of that are compliance rules and regulations for some industries, including collections, that dictate document content and often restrict when documents can be sent digitally. These rules vary by state and change frequently.
